Client-Centered Therapy
A psychotherapeutic approach developed by Carl Rogers focusing on providing a supportive environment allowing clients to lead their own therapy process.
Nondirective
A therapeutic approach in which the counselor or therapist provides support and guidance but does not give direct advice or instructions to the client.
Insight Therapies
Insight Therapies focus on increasing a patient's awareness of underlying psychological problems and motivations to facilitate change and personal growth.
Psychological Health
A state of well-being where an individual realizes his or her own abilities, can cope with normal stresses of life, work productively, and contribute to the community.
